Github-integrated background agents, automating end-to-end software engineering, fully open source. 🚀 Quick Start 🤝 Contributing 🪨 What is Cairn? Cairn is a simple open-source background-agent system for coding, built in the style of a product management tool. Think Codex, Jules, or Cursor Background Agents, but open sourced!
